Household of Jantien Eissen

She is married to Willem Scholten.

They were married in church on May 8, 1766 at Nieuw-Schoonebeek.


Child(ren):

  1. Zwaantien Scholten  ????-1773
  2. Evert Scholten  1768-1842 
  3. Jan Scholten  1770-1834 
  4. Zwaantien Scholten  1774-1833
  5. Albert Scholten  1788-????
